Mark Galeotti dives deep into the enigmatic life of Yevgeny Prigozhin, a formidable warlord and rival of Vladimir Putin. He discusses Prigozhin's rise through the culinary elite in St. Petersburg and his path to leading the Wagner Group. The podcast uncovers the Kremlin's manipulation of loyalty and misinformation while analyzing the repercussions of Prigozhin’s actions post-coup. Galeotti speculates on Russia's future, highlighting the potential for a generational shift in leadership and its implications for democracy amid ongoing chaos.

Examining Prigozhin's Role

The discussion revolves around Prigozhin’s complex character and his relationship with the Putin regime. Initially, the authors hesitated to write about him due to his unfriendly reputation. However, they recognized that Prigozhin's life illustrates how the Putin regime evolved and relied on individuals like him. The timing of their book's proposal became urgent following Prigozhin's attempted mutiny, marking a significant moment in Russian political dynamics.
